Anthropic Seeks SK Hynix Memory Supply for Custom AI Chips

SK Group Chairman Chey Tae-won revealed that AI startup Anthropic has approached SK Hynix to secure memory chips for its custom AI hardware project. This follows reports that Anthropic has initiated early development of its own AI chips and is in talks with Samsung Electronics for manufacturing. Anthropic's move to design custom silicon highlights a growing industry trend where major AI labs seek to reduce their reliance on Nvidia's dominant GPUs. Securing high-performance memory from SK Hynix is crucial for building competitive AI accelerators capable of handling massive workloads. Anthropic is reportedly exploring Samsung's 2nm foundry process and advanced packaging technologies for its custom chip project. SK Hynix is a dominant player in High Bandwidth Memory (HBM), which is essential for powering modern AI processors.

## BACKGROUND

High Bandwidth Memory (HBM) is a 3D-stacked memory architecture that provides massive data throughput, solving critical bottlenecks for AI accelerators. Advanced packaging is a semiconductor manufacturing technique that integrates multiple dies or chiplets, such as logic processors and HBM, into a single high-performance device.
